Cream Unicorn Cookie is a Healer classy cookie. They are very suitable for the Arena as they have a buff that reduces the CRIT DMG received from allies. In addition, they provide a “Silence” debuff to the enemy team. The debuff causes them to pause momentarily and blocks the cooldown of their abilities. Next, they summon butterflies that heal the entire team, which is healed in proportion to the amount of damage their allies take. Subsequently, the entire party gains a DMG Resistance buff.

Since Cream Unicorn is a healer and is always positioned at the back of the team, Vampire cookie it’s a good counter for them. Another single target cookie that targets the back is Red velvet cookie although it is currently not as used in Arena as Vampire Cookie is more versatile.

Most of the time, Cream Unicorn Cookie uses both Quick chocolate or Whole almonds.

1. Swift chocolate

A full set of Swift Chocolate toppings on Cream Unicorn Cookie allows them to use their skills as frequently as possible. If you are going to use this set for them, we recommend that you get as much DMG Resist as possible. We recommend that you get at least 25% resistance to DMG so they can dab some of the Vampire Cookie successes. You can also opt for some cooldown, ATK, and CRIT subs on them, but DMG stamina is the top priority.

2. Whole almonds

For a more defensive build, you can also use Whole Almonds. Like Swift Chocolate, you should try to get as much DMG Resist on their build as possible. Provides a full set of whole almonds 20.5% DMG resistance and an additional 5% from the “set effect” bonus, up to 25.5%. Since the maximum DMG Resist, you can get from the toppings substats 6%, in theory you can have 50.5% DMG resistance on them.

However, the best you can usually do is in the 45% to 49%, since it’s hard to get good secondary topping stats. Since this isn’t a Swift Chocolate set, Cream Unicorn would perform their attacks much less frequently. Try to get good secondary cooldown stats to compensate for less frequent heals!

Here are the secondary stats to focus on:

  • DMG Resist
  • Resist criticism
  • Cool down
  • HP
  • ATK
  • CRITIC
  • ATK speed

DMG Resist and CRIT Resist are useful in the arena. ATK speed is also recommended because they have a slow skill effect time, so a lot of ATK speed substats and the use of enchanted librarian robes would help Cream Unicorn do their skills faster.

While Seared raspberries And Juicy apple jellies they are great toppings, they are Not suitable for Cream Unicorn Cookie, especially as their main healing ability doesn’t scale from ATK or CRIT.
